Discover the vibrant tapestry of queer women's history in Place of Our Own, Six Spaces That Shaped Queer Women's Culture by June Thomas. This insightful book, published in 2025, delves into the significance of six key spaces that have fostered community, creativity, and resilience among lesbian women. With a page count of 304, Thomas invites readers to explore the joyful celebration of these unique environments and their profound impact on queer culture. Val McDermid praises it as 'A cracking read,' highlighting its engaging narrative and rich historical context.
